Output 362e3fbba1a0f9d30683623d65eb00001c9926d4508c66ba25e853b1a252ff96:0

value
151443800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a608447c30a73cb8f8702723fd483f32deb1cc9 OP_EQUAL
address
3Cr5z3e8SXsH7gPtjTvDXxqMiU7oQLTQy6
transaction
362e3fbba1a0f9d30683623d65eb00001c9926d4508c66ba25e853b1a252ff96
spent
true